The theme of this year's exhibition is "Aizome". Aizome is an ancient dyeing method that uses the plant indigo. In the city, there were several indigo-dyeing businesses called "konya," which were contracted by farmers and others to dye their products with indigo dye. The exhibit introduces materials donated by the families that worked as konya, indigo-dyed kasuri, and other items. date(s) (e.g. for exhibition) Thursday, May 1, 2025 - Friday, June 27, 2025 Hours of operation 9:00-17:00 Location Kiyose City Folk Museum 1F Folk Exhibition Room admission fee free Click here for exhibition details→ Kiyose City Website (external link)
